Main Office
2616 SW Union Ter, Port St Lucie, FL 34953-2982
(772) 288-7113
We Are Here
Air Conditioning Contractors & Systems in Port St Lucie, Florida
Air Conditioning Equipment Repair in FL 34953
Air Conditioning Equipment Repair in Port St Lucie, Florida